Shelties were originally developed as herding dogs in the Shetland Islands of Scotland and their herding instincts are often apparent even in a more urban setting. In the absence of livestock, Shetland Sheepdogs will happily herd cats, squirrels, and neighborhood children. These small-statured but sturdy canines are particularly devoted to their families and have developed a reputation as Velcro dogs due to their preference for staying as close to their human companions as possible. While Shelties make excellent companion animals, they were bred to be very active dogs. They require a great deal of physical and mental exercise throughout their lives in order to remain happy and healthy. Fortunately, they are also extremely intelligent and can excel in many different roles, including those of canine athlete, show dog, animal actor, or therapy/service animal. The Shetland Sheepdog, more commonly referred to as a "Sheltie," is a dog breed with Scottish roots. The origin of their name suggests that these dogs were formerly used to herd sheep. - The designation "Sheepdog" refers to the dog's principal function in helping shepherds control and relocate their sheep herds. They herd sheep with remarkable intelligence and agility, and are widely regarded for these traits. - The kind and affectionate temperament of the Shetland Sheepdog makes it a great companion animal. Often mistaken for small Rough Collies, another herding breed, they are well-known for their stunning appearance. The Shetland sheepdog is a medium-sized breed of dog that is easily recognizable by its thick double coat, pointed ears, and unique "mane" of hair around the neck. In conclusion, the "Shetland Sheepdog" moniker refers to the breed's original function of protecting and herding sheep on the Shetland Islands.
